" Criticism is a prerequisite for greatness" #leadership #ODGAfrica.9. Commitment to growth. Effective servant leaders motivate their teams to grow. They are committed to helping their teams develop professionally. Servant leaders help their team members become leaders themselves by leading by example and providing their team with opportunities to grow and develop.Keys to leadership. Leadership is not by birth but by a vision that … university honors program When a problem arises, solution-oriented leaders don’t sit around waiting for a solution to present itself—they get out there and take action to find the solution themselves. “Leaders who are solution-oriented are really focused on action conversations ,” says Heather Marasse, Executive Coach and Managing Partner of …Managers can use legitimate power together with other types of power to be successful leaders. 2. Coercive power. Coercive power is the power someone gains through threat or force. For example, a higher-ranking manager forcing a lower-ranking employee to perform tasks or face disciplinary action is a coercive leader.Bishop's Bulletin Accept the Call to Leadership!
